Output 59e8fab7529eab12ad72ae599fc36e37963266aef25ac09566f59887a5431587:2

value
1421
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d52168252b41298586a6d08bb923dbc247c91e91938693a44a3f0bcd85821b9b
address
bc1p65sksfftgy5ctp4x6z9mjg7mcfruj853jwrf8fz28u9umpvzrwdsjsfwhx
transaction
59e8fab7529eab12ad72ae599fc36e37963266aef25ac09566f59887a5431587
spent
true